Michela Onali

Michela Onali

Stakeholder Manager

Michela has a Bachelor in Language Mediation and a Master’s Degree in Euro-Med policies and cross-border cooperation in the Mediterranean region. 

 

In 2018 she relocated to Italy after working for several years in formal and non-formal education in Turkey and then Canada. Since her return to Europe, she has been involved in Rare Disease advocacy at a European, national and regional level and has contributed to projects and initiatives in Europe aimed at fostering multi-stakekolder collaboration, early and meaningful patient partnership in basic, pre-clinical and translational research for rare diseases. 

 

Michela is a patient with an ultra rare-disease called GNE Myopathy, a muscle disease and congenital disorder of glycosylation (CDG). She is a EURORDIS Summer School and Winter School alumna and a EUPATI Fellow. She speaks Italian, English, Spanish and Turkish.

 

Michela joined MetabERN in May 2022 to support the team in the strategic, tactical and coordination activities of the network.
